E M B A R C Community Youth Farm The E.M.B.A.R.C. Community Youth Farm is located in DeKalb County, GA and is the vision of Commissioner Lorraine Cochran-Johnson.

It stands for Education, Market, Botanicals, Agriculture, and Recreational Center.

Overview
Join us for a relaxing morning of fishing at the EMBARC pond and celebrate the father figures in your life.

Join us as we partner with Georgia DNR for a relaxing morning of fishing at the EMBARC Youth Farm's pond to celebrate Father's Day. As you enter the gate of the park, you will follow the sign for parking and park in the horse corral on the right at the top of the hill. There will be signs and cones to help with parking.

We will have equipment to borrow, but feel free to bring your own gear if you'd like. We also highly encourage life jackets be worn by children under the age of 10 or any participants who don't know how to swim.

We will have worms available, but feel free to bring any favorite lures or bait.

Wear comfortable, weather-appropriate clothing as well as your own water and snacks. The pond is approximately 500 yards away from the parking, so you are welcome to bring wagons or other containers to help move equipment from your car to the pond.

If you have an easily transportable camp chair or outdoor sitting mat, feel free to bring those as well since there is limited seating provided. Bring a hat, sunglasses, and sunscreen for sun protection, as well as insect repellent to keep the bugs at bay.

Space is limited, so please make sure to reserve your tickets early! Children under 12 do not need a reserved ticket.

We look forward to seeing you at the Farm!

E.M.B.A.R.C. Youth Farm Summer Camp is BACK!!

Session 1 - June 1st - 5th
Session 2 - June 8th - 12th

A camp like no other! Shaded by trees and surrounded by lush forest, the E.M.B.A.R.C. Youth Farm summer camp is designed for boys and girls ages 8-12 looking to experience the outdoors like a
true Ranger. We believe every camper brings incredible skills and talents with them that they have yet to discover. We strive to develop their hidden strengths through our Ranger-led activities that are sure to be remembered for summers to come. Activities vary depending on the day's theme, but each day will involve planting activities and nature lessons. Additionally, each camper will have the opportunities for play time, games, etc. in the gardens and fields.

Camp takes place exclusively outside, so participants must dress accordingly. Participants are required to wear closed-toe shoes and bring a reusable water bottle. We encourage long pants and hats during hot days. Sunscreen and bug spray will be available on site.

Fee: Residents $66 / Non-residents $66 + $20

All youth campers are expected to bring their own snacks and lunch each day.

Parents may begin to drop off participants no earlier than 8:30 am. Breakfast and programming begins at 9:00 am.
Pick up must be by 4:30 pm.

May 2, 2026 8:30 am - 11:30 am

A hands-on educational program that teaches participants how to design, plant, and maintain a pollinator-friendly garden using native plants. The program highlights the importance of pollinators such as bees, butterflies, and birds to ecosystem health and food systems.

This workshop is led by Sades of Green Permaculture

EE Week is back!

For the past 50 years, Project Learning Tree has helped teach young minds how to think, not what to think, about complex environmental issues and learn the problem-solving skills they need to make informed choices about the environment. For the next 50 years, PLT and organizations like the National Environmental Education Foundation - NEEF will continue to prioritize the environmental education that will create champions for our planet.

In celebration of Earth Week, Monarchs Across Georgia is hosting a special screening of The Extraordinary Caterpillar, a beautifully shot 60-minute documentary that reveals the vital—and often overlooked—role caterpillars play in our ecosystems.

Watch the trailer here! https://vimeo.com/1117213704

From blooming meadows to city parks and backyard gardens, this inspiring film celebrates the magic of nature while showing families practical ways to make a difference.
Along the way, you’ll see the groundbreaking work of The Caterpillar Lab, entomologist David Wagner, and Doug Tallamy, co-founder of Homegrown National Park.

DATE: Thursday, April 23, 2026

TIME: 7 - 8 PM (Doors will open at 6:30 PM)

LOCATION: Agnes Scott College, Campbell Hall, Graves Auditorium, 141 East College Avenue, Decatur, GA, 30030
Free visitor parking is available at the West Parking Facility, 137 S. McDonough Street. CAMPUS MAP

TICKET PRICING: $15

PRESENTED BY: Monarchs Across Georgia committee of the Environmental Education Alliance

What you’ll get:
Inspiring stories about why caterpillars are essential to healthy ecosystems
Simple steps you can take to create habitat in your own yard or community
Free handouts to help you take action right away

This is a chance to see nature in a whole new light—and to be part of the movement to bring it home. We hope you’ll join us.
